LOOK is a site-specific performance that unfolds within the saturation of contemporary media landscapes. A striving body is gradually overtaken—absorbed into a flow of images, information, and projections that blur the boundaries between self and representation.

As layers accumulate, identity begins to fragment. The face—once a marker of presence—dissolves into a surface shaped by external forces. The work moves through states of hyper-normalisation, where repetition and exposure create a sense of detachment from lived experience.

What remains when perception is mediated to this extent? LOOK traces the tension between visibility and disappearance, questioning how the self is constructed, distorted, and ultimately displaced within a media-saturated environment.

Commissioned by Bolzano Danza, the work was presented in various site-specific contexts across Europe, amongst others at Bolzano Danza, Mittelfest (IT), and La Bequée Festival (FR).

Duration: 20 minutes
